This article explains how to position the A13J with the Alea NXT eye tracker.

As a general guide, position the eye-gaze device 20 to 24 inches in front of the client’s face, with the bottom of the device approximately 6 inches below their chin.
Take into consideration your client’s presentation and eyesight, adjusting the device according to their individual needs.
1. Connect the A13J to the mount and plug in the ADT USB cable. Adjust the mount at its different axes to get the device into approximate position.
2. Open the positioning guide by clicking on the Home button in the IntelliGaze Operation Bar.
3. With the client seated in the power wheelchair, reference the positioning guide while making adjustments until their face appears centered and green.
4. You are now ready to calibrate the eye tracker.
